CB25 0DF is a residential postcode in Burwell, Cambridgeshire. It was first introduced in September 2006.
The most common council tax band is D.
Residential buildings are primarily detached. Domestic properties are mostly bungalows and houses.
Estimated residential property values, based on historical transactions and adjusted for inflation, range from £97,731 to £694,586 with an average of £329,096.
Residential buildings were typically constructed between 1950 and 1966.
2% of residential property sales since 1995 have been new builds or newly converted.
Domestic properties are predominantly owner occupied.
The most common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) ratings are D and E.
Burwell is a village, which had a population of 6,309 in the 2011 census.
In the 2011 census, there were 204 people resident in CB25 0DF, of which 103 were male and 101 were female. This includes overnight visitors as well as permanent residents.
CB25 0DF is in the Cambridge travel to work area. NHS services are provided by the Cambridgeshire Primary Care Trust.
CB25 0DF is approximately 15m (49ft) above sea level.
